Welcome, Guest
Username: Password: Remember me
1. The "search..." box above searches the Docs & Forum Posts. The "Search" tab above just searches the Forum Posts. :side:
Please use these to search for your issue *before* creating a new message topic, as your issue may have been previously solved.
2. Please put your Club # and Club Web Address in your Forum Signature (best) OR in each post to get faster support from us.
Click here to edit your signature at the bottom of the Profile Information tab.
3. Our user and admin docs are available at: support.toastmastersclubs.org/doc "There's a doc for that!" ;)
4. There is an "Opt In" Feature for newly added members. The Opt In document explains the strikethrough member information. Click Here to View the Post
5. When posting a New Topic , please include all relevant details and be specific. When did your issue 1st occur? What operating system, browser, & browser version are you using? Did you refresh your browser cache? Are your cookies enabled? Lastly, a screen shot is often helpful.
6. Please abide by the Terms of Use . We are volunteers contributing our spare time. We are happy to assist you, so long as you are respectful and courteous.
7. We are always looking for new FreeToastHost Ambassadors to join our team and support fellow Toastmasters in their use of the FreeToastHost website system. If you are familiar with the system and have some interest, send a Send Us a Private Message.
  • Page:
  • 1

TOPIC:

Two members signed up for same role after logging in around same time 6 years 3 months ago #71857

  • brassaf
  • brassaf's Avatar Topic Author
  • Offline
  • New Member
  • New Member
  • Posts: 4
  • Thank you received: 1
At our club website ( 4640768 / oracleatl.toastmastersclubs.org/ ) we had a timing issue show up yesterday:

Both Wilfred and Pam logged in with a couple minutes of each other. Only after both logged in did the following happen:

They both noticed that Eval #1 and Joke Master roles were open.

4:35 Wilfred signed up for Eval #1
4:35 Wilfred confirmed Eval #1
4:36 Pam signed up for Eval #1
4:36 Pam confirmed Eval #1
4:36 Wilfred signed up for Joke Master
4:36 Wilfred confirmed Joke Master
4:36 Pam signed up for Presiding Officer
4:36 Pam confirmed Pres Officer
4:42 Pam signed up for Joke Master
4:42 Pam confirmed Joke Master

So in the end, Pam's roles "stuck" and Wilfred's were overwritten. I'm guessing this is quite uncommon but may have happened before. I scanned the forums briefly for anyone else reporting this but didn't see it at first glance.

Suggestion is to disallow someone from signing up for a role, if someone else has already claimed a role, even though the page wasn't updated with the first sign-up.

Cheers,
Bernard Assaf, website admin, Oracle Atlanta Toastmasters

Please Log in or Create an account to join the conversation.

Two members signed up for same role after logging in around same time 6 years 3 months ago #71868

  • SteveTheTechie
  • SteveTheTechie's Avatar
  • Offline
  • FreeToastHost Developer
  • FreeToastHost Developer
  • Posts: 13529
  • Thank you received: 3831
You are correct that it is a timing issue. But it is a bit complicated for a number of reasons.

I can send timestamps of agenda rows to the browser on page refreshes and data updates so that they can be sent back on saves for comparison, but the thorny question is what to do if a clash is discovered.

If you consider that this can also happen in the agenda editor, it gets even more complex since data for multiple updated rows can be sent to the server. There could be a case where some rows were updated and do not clash, but some do. So do I block the save or do I do a partial save? :?

Don't get me wrong. This is something I have been aware of for a while (also see support.toastmastersclubs.org/2011-10-23...-edit-meeting-agenda) and would like to resolve, but most of the solutions are messy and convoluted. For example, I could do a sort of "check-out/check-in" kind of thing to ensure that only one person is editing data at one time, but then I have to contend with the scenario where data is never checked back in. (It would happen)
Regards,

Steve James, DTM
FreeToastHost System Developer
Officer Emeritus, Mindful Communicators (Club 1966, District 52) A President's Distinguished Club for each of the last 10 years.

>>> Please put your club number in your forum profile. CLICK here to edit your profile.
The following user(s) said Thank You: brassaf

Please Log in or Create an account to join the conversation.

Last edit: by SteveTheTechie.

Two members signed up for same role after logging in around same time 6 years 3 months ago #71873

  • brassaf
  • brassaf's Avatar Topic Author
  • Offline
  • New Member
  • New Member
  • Posts: 4
  • Thank you received: 1
Agreed it is a messy technical issue. Glad you are already aware of it. Since our club's inception in April 2015 we hadn't had this issue (that I know of) so it isn't something that happens often!
The following user(s) said Thank You: SteveTheTechie

Please Log in or Create an account to join the conversation.

  • Page:
  • 1
Moderators: Pamrhtaylor3jliumarc33NotLiabledeedubbleyooNSBPhyllis Kirouac
Time to create page: 0.057 seconds
Powered by Kunena Forum